Riley first gained recognition in the 1960s for her optically engaging abstract paintings. By the late 1970s - in large works such as this one - she had evolved away from black-and-white geometric patterning toward an increasingly complex focus on creating "colored light" through repeated juxtapositions of bands of color. Although tightly controlled, the surface of this painting seems to undulate as precisely placed lines of complementary colors twist, alternately emerging and melding together.
